Lore

Aaron Mahnke launched Lore in 2015, and it quickly became one of the defining podcasts of the mystery and dark history genre. The show now has over 700 episodes and has been adapted into a TV series, a book series, and a touring live show. Each episode explores a real historical event or belief that reveals something unsettling about human nature -- think the origins of vampire folklore, the real history behind infamous haunted houses, or the strange medical practices that terrified entire communities. Mahnke narrates solo with a calm, deliberate cadence that feels like someone telling you a story by firelight. The production features original music by composer Chad Lawson, which adds genuine atmosphere without becoming distracting. Episodes typically run 20 to 35 minutes, and new installments release weekly through Grim and Mild Studios. The show has earned a 4.6-star rating from over 44,000 reviews on Apple Podcasts, making it one of the most widely reviewed podcasts in any genre. Mahnke excels at finding the human stories inside historical mysteries -- the fear, the superstition, the desperation that drove people to extraordinary actions. More recently, the show has expanded its lens to include more diverse historical perspectives, particularly around colonialism and Indigenous history.
